The Fernwick OTA channel switcher in this patch looks correct, but note that the staged-rollout percentages are now hardcoded in `channel.c` rather than pulled from the Larkspur config service. That's fine for the hotfix, but flag it for the next release train so we don't fork the values. For reference, these are the constants the firmware will ship with in build 4.2.

tuning table, hafog-bahaf:
QUOTAS = {
    "praion": 144,
    "briax": 906,
    "silwyn": 451,
}

UserSplit Cutover Drift: the extracted account service and the legacy Marigold monolith user module are reporting divergent record counts during dual-write. This fires when drift exceeds 0.5% over 15 minutes. New team members should not replay writes manually. Reconciliation steps and the rollback procedure are documented on the internal page.

wiki page, tajog-fafog: https://gitlab.paliqsys.corp/dash/display/job/853dd6fcbf54

TICKET-4412: Expired credentials blocking cache-invalidation audit. During the Lorvex stale-cache postmortem we found the purge daemon silently failing since the rotation on the Quillbase side. No alerts fired; stale entries served for 11 hours. Rotation runbook updated. Security review requested before re-enable. The replacement key for the purge daemon is as follows.

API key for yahig-tadup: kto7_ubizbYm